Homecoming for Kaeding
JPM Photo by Bill Sullivan

CHICO, CA (9-1-05) - Former Silver Dollar Speedway champion Tim Kaeding of San Jose will celebrate a homecoming next week at Silver Dollar Speedway when he returns with the traveling World of Outlaw Sprint Car Series to compete in the 52nd Gold Cup Race of Champions. Over 80 teams are expected to compete for the more than $160,000 offered by track promoter John Padjen. The giant event will be held Wednesday through Saturday September 7, 8, 9, and 10.

Kaeding has spent the year on the road with the National Tour after capturing the Silver Dollar Speedway Mini-Gold Cup this past March. He already had etched his way into the Silver Dollar record book with track championships in 1998 and 2001. He also scored a statewide championship in Golden State Challenge winged sprint car series before joining the Outlaws. His tenacity in Chico has been widely recognized as a combination of talent and guts. He rides the wild side around the ¼ mile clay oval and rarely flinches at danger. He will ride the same Dennis Roth Beef Packer car that he won the Mini Gold Cup in.

Kaeding’s teammate and second place finisher in the Mini Gold Cup, Jac Haudenschild of Wooster, Ohio has also been known for his flamboyant driving style that earned him the nickname of “Wild Child”. His entry in a second Dennis Roth owned car that will assure race fans plenty of action during the 2005 Gold Cup Race of Champions. Haudenschild has twice won the Gold Cup in 1998 and 1999.

Other former Gold Cup Champions expected include Steve Kinser of Bloomington, Indiana, North Dakota’s Donny Schatz, and Missouri’s Danny Lasoski.

Locally, former World of Outlaw star Jonathan Allard of Chico will join 2005 track champion Sean Becker of Sacramento to uphold the honors of the track regulars. Becker also captured the Golden State challenge title this year, but it was Allard who displayed all the flash winning 5 of the 7 races he ran during the regular season, plus establishing a new all time track record of 11.307 seconds.

Complete race programs will be held each night. Wednesday will feature the Civil War sprint cars and BCRA midget lites. The Outlaws will race Thursday through Saturday. All Wednesday nights seats are general admission on a first come basis. The ticket box office and front gate open at 5 PM on Wednesday. The remaining nights tickets will be available before race day at the track office located behind the main grandstand beginning Monday September 5th.
